Kateb

Kateb is a surname, and may refer to; Kateb derives from كاتب which means scribe in Arabic.

Meaning: Writer, scribe Origin: Arabic

Katib

Katib. ... Kâtib is a term used to describe the position of writer, scribe, or secretary in the Arabic-speaking world, Persian World, and other Islamic areas as far as India.

Meaning: Scribe, Writer Origin: Arabic

Kausar

Kausar is a Muslim given name for males or females, which means "abundance" or "a river or lake in paradise". The name is a reference to Hauzu'l-Kausar, a sacred lake called the "pond of abundance" in Paradise in the Quran.

Meaning: Lake of paradise, Abundance, 108th Surah of the Quran Origin: Arabic
